AP® 2021 Scoring GuidelinesThe AP World History exam is 3 hours and 15 minutes long. Section I is 1 hour and 35 minutes long and consists of 55 multiple-choice questions and 3 short-answer questions. Section II is 1 hour and 40 minutes long and consists of one document-based question (DBQ) and one long essay question (LEQ).

The WHAP FRQ section consists of two essays: the DBQ and the LEQ. The DBQ is an essay in which you have to answer a given prompt using seven documents that interpret the historical event. The LEQ is an essay with a variety of prompts where you have to create an argument without any stimuli.AP History Long Essay Question (LEQ) Rubric (6 points) THESIS/CLAIM. (0–1 pt) Responds to the prompt with a historically defensible thesis/claim that establishes a line of reasoning.
